First and foremost, user experience is paramount when it comes to ecommerce website design Your website should be intuitively designed, with clear navigation and easy-to-use features that make the shopping experience seamless for visitors Make sure to include a search bar, clear product categories, and a straightforward checkout process to help users find what they’re looking for and complete their purchases hassle-free.
Another crucial aspect of ecommerce website design is mobile responsiveness With more and more people shopping on their smartphones and tablets, it’s essential that your website is optimized for mobile devices A responsive design ensures that your website looks and functions perfectly on any screen size, providing a consistent experience for users across all devices.
When it comes to the visual aspect of your ecommerce website, it’s important to pay attention to branding and aesthetics Your website should reflect your brand identity, with a cohesive color scheme, typography, and imagery that align with your brand message High-quality product photos and videos can also make a significant impact on potential customers, showcasing your products in the best possible light and increasing conversions.

Your website should have robust product search and filtering options, as well as easy-to-use shopping cart and checkout functionalities It’s also crucial to have clear calls to action (CTAs) throughout the site, guiding users towards making a purchase or signing up for newsletters or promotions.
Security is another critical consideration for ecommerce websites Customers need to feel confident that their personal and payment information is secure when making a purchase online Make sure to implement SSL encryption, secure payment gateways, and other security measures to protect your customers’ data and build trust with them.
SEO (search engine optimization) is also essential for ecommerce website design Optimizing your website for search engines can help improve your visibility in search results, driving more organic traffic to your site Make sure to include relevant keywords in your product descriptions, meta tags, and URLs, as well as optimizing your site structure and content for search engines.
Lastly, analytics and tracking are crucial for evaluating the success of your ecommerce website and making data-driven decisions to improve performance By using tools like Google Analytics, you can track key metrics such as website traffic, conversion rates, and user behavior, giving valuable insights into how users interact with your site and where improvements can be made.
